Cursode Java 5 Edition
Cursode Java 5 Edition
Prueba realizada
Tus respuestas
El código fuente de los programas de Java se escribe en ficheros con extensión "java"
El código fuente de los programas de Java se escribe en ficheros con extensión "class"
Cuando se compila un archivo fuente de java se genera un archivo con extensión "class".
2. ¿Qué afirmación es incorrecta?
a += b significa a = (a + b)
a *= b significa a = (a * b)
a != b significa a = (a ! b)
a %= b significa a = (a % b)
3. ¿Cuál será el valor de la variable a después de ejecutar el
siguiente código?
int a=0,b=0,i=10;
for(;i>b;){
a=b++;
}
11
10
0
4. ¿Cuál es la salida del código siguiente?
int i=0;
while(i++<10){
if (++i%3!=0) continue;
System.out.print (" El numero es "+i);
}
El número es 1 El número es 2
El número es 2 El número es 3
El número es 6
5. ¿Qué sentencia de creación de array es incorrecta?:
Tus respuestas
4
2. Dada la siguiente jerarquía de clases:
abstract class primera {
int x;
public primera() {
x = 8;
}
public abstract void imprimir();
}
class segunda extends primera {
public void imprimir() {
x = 10;
}
public void incrementar() {
x++;
}
}
package com.ejemplos.*;
package clases;
package com.ejemplos.clases;
d. package com.ejemplos.clases.herencia.banco;
5. ¿Qué afirmación es incorrecta?
Evaluación módulo 3
Prueba realizada
Tu resultado en el test ha sido: 100
Tus respuestas
FileInputStream
FileOutputStream
FileStream
FileWriteStream
3. ¿Cuál de los elementos de la lista siguiente no es un interface?
List.
Set.
ArrayList.
Map
4. ¿Cuál es la salida del siguiente código?
public class Test {
public static void main(String... sss) {
HashSet<Object> miSet = new
HashSet<Object>();
String s1 = new String("hola");
String s2 = new String("hola");
Simple s3 = new Simple("holasimple");
Simple s4 = new Simple("holasimple");
miSet.add(s1);
miSet.add(s2);
miSet.add(s3);
miSet.add(s4);
System.out.println(miSet);
}
}
class Simple {
private String str;
Simple(String str) {
this.str = str;
}
public String toString() {
return str;
}
}
init()
resume()
run()
start()
Evaluación módulo 4
Prueba realizada
Tu resultado en el test ha sido: 100
Tus respuestas
2. Teniendo en cuenta la interface siguiente:
interface Multi{
public int multiplicar(int p1,int p2);
}
¿Cuál de las siguientes sentencias creará una instancia de
dicha interface?
La cadena con el itinerario de paquetes y clase del driver de la base de datos, el usuario y la
clave de acceso.
4. ¿De las siguientes funciones cuál es la más apropiada para
recorrer el contenido de la ejecución de una sentencia SELECT que
produce un conjunto de filas de una base de datos?
ResultSet executeQuery()
boolean execute()
ResultSet executeSelect()
int executeUpdate()
5. ¿Cuántos parámetros (?) puede tener la sentencia SQL INSERT
que se debe pasar como parámetro a la función
prepareStatement?
Como mínimo tantos como campos estén definidos como NOT NULL.
Todos los métodos tienen que ser abstract, menos uno default.